We're looking for a Senior Product Lead to join Admiral's GenAI Centre of Excellence and lead the development of Generative AI products across our Claims function. Working closely with Claims, Data Science, Technology and senior business leaders, you'll define and deliver a portfolio of AI-enabled solutions that improve customer outcomes, increase efficiency, reduce costs and strengthen fraud detection. This is a strategic role where you'll own the product vision and roadmap, identify high-value opportunities across the claims journey, and ensure AI investments deliver measurable business impact.

What you'll be doing:

  • Define and own the GenAI product strategy and roadmap for Claims
  • Identify opportunities to apply AI across the end-to-end claims lifecycle
  • Partner with Claims leaders to solve business challenges through AI products
  • Prioritise initiatives based on customer, operational and commercial value
  • Work closely with Product, Data Science, Engineering and Technology teams to deliver solutions
  • Champion responsible AI, governance and regulatory compliance
  • Drive experimentation, innovation and continuous improvement
  • Present recommendations, business cases and outcomes to senior stakeholders

Essential skills and experience:

  • Significant experience within insurance claims, ideally motor, home or personal lines
  • Strong understanding of claims operations, processes and economics
  • Proven product leadership experience in a complex and regulated environment
  • Experience delivering data, analytics or AI-enabled products
  • Good understanding of Generative AI, large language models and emerging AI technologies
  • Strong stakeholder management and influencing skills
  • Commercial mindset with the ability to build business cases and prioritise investment decisions
  • Ability to translate between technical and non-technical audiences

Everyone receives 33 days holiday (including bank holidays) when they join us, increasing the longer you stay with us, up to a maximum of 38 days (including bank holidays). You also have the option to buy or sell up to an additional five days of annual leave. We're proud of our people-first culture.
